Festivals

Independence Day

Season or date: July 26

The largest celebration with military parades and dancing nationwide

Flag Day

Season or date: August 24

School events and community parades celebrating flag adoption

Pioneer Day

Season or date: January 7

Commemorating the first Americo-Liberian settlers

Decoration Day

Season or date: Second Wednesday in March

Day of remembrance to clean ancestors'' graves and decorate with flowers

National Unification Day

Season or date: May 14

Official ceremonies and cultural performances promoting ethnic harmony

Fast and Prayer Day

Season or date: Second Friday in April

Interfaith prayer day wishing for national peace

Thanksgiving

Season or date: First Thursday in November

American-origin tradition giving thanks to God and nation

Armed Forces Day

Season or date: February 11

Military parade celebrating army founding

Eid al-Fitr

Season or date: Around Islamic month 10, day 1

Muslims gather with family for feasts

Christmas

Season or date: December 25

Church masses and carnival-style parades enliven the day
